Transaction: Gift of four ploughgates in Conveth (Laurencekirk, KCD)

Type of Transaction
Gift
From Source
1/6/315 (RRS, ii, no. 344)
Firm date
1189 X 1195
Probable date
1189 × circa 1193
Dating Notes
Appointment of Hugh to chancellorship × introduction of date of time to royal acts; probably about the same time as <em>RRS</em> ii, no. 345
Primary
yes
Dare
yes
Tenendas
in feu and heritage; of me and my heirs
Tenendas original language
de me et heredibus meis in feodo et hereditate
Legal Pertinents
infangthief; sake and soke; toll and team
Returns / Military
fraction of a knight
Notes
four ploughgates which Agatha gave in exchange for Ardoyne (ABD)
